I have a 1971 Pinto with the 2.0 motor. I learned that the engines came with either an Autolite OR of Bosch distributor AFTER I had ordered a Pertronix unit for a Bosch distributor. How do I tell what distributor I have?

Identification problem solved! Bosch distributors have the condensor mounted on the outside of the body of the distributor, Autolite distributors have the condensor mounted under the distributor cap. That is according to my 71 FSM anyway. Looks like I have a Bosch unit. Yay! Now I know my Pertronix will fit.
